Comprehending Addiction as a Chronic Disease
Addiction is not regarding making poor decisions; it is a complicated brain condition. The American Medical Association (AMA) and the National Institute on Drug Abuse (NIDA) define addiction as a chronic, relapsing disease that alters mind chemistry. When an individual consistently uses substances, it affects the mind's reward system, making it significantly hard to quit.
Much like conditions such as diabetic issues or high blood pressure, addiction requires correct monitoring and treatment. The brain undergoes long-term adjustments, particularly in locations in charge of judgment, decision-making, and impulse control. This is why stopping on sheer self-control alone is usually not successful. Medical treatments, therapy, and support systems are essential to handle the disease properly.
The Science Behind Addiction and Brain Changes
Compound use pirates the brain's typical features, leading to uncontrollable behaviors and dependence. Drugs and alcohol flooding the brain with dopamine, a natural chemical responsible for sensations of pleasure and benefit. Over time, the mind adapts, requiring more of the material to accomplish the very same effect. This is referred to as resistance, and it typically leads to boosted intake, withdrawal symptoms, and a cycle of reliance.
Mind imaging studies have actually shown that dependency influences the prefrontal cortex, the part of the brain responsible for sensible decision-making. This explains why people having problem with substance use commonly proceed their behavior in spite of unfavorable effects. They are passing by dependency; their minds have actually been rewired to prioritize substances over whatever else.
Why Stigma Prevents People from Seeking Help
In spite of the overwhelming scientific evidence, stigma stays among the greatest obstacles to recuperation. Many individuals wait to look for drug treatment because they fear judgment from household, pals, or culture. This embarassment and seclusion can make dependency even worse, pressing people deeper right into compound usage.
Stigma likewise impacts public policies and health care methods. Rather than seeing addiction as a medical issue, many still treat it as a criminal or ethical falling short. This strategy leads to inadequate financing for therapy programs, restricted access to methadone treatment, and social denial of harm-reduction approaches. If we intend to enhance healing results, we should shift our perspective and welcome evidence-based remedies.
The Role of Medication-Assisted Treatment (MAT)
One of one of the most efficient methods to manage dependency is with Medication-Assisted Treatment (MAT). MAT combines drugs with therapy and behavioral therapies to provide a holistic strategy to healing. For individuals with opioid usage condition, methadone maintenance treatment can be a game-changer.
Methadone is a long-acting opioid agonist that helps reduce food cravings and withdrawal signs. Unlike illicit opioids, it does not discover this create the same blissful impacts, permitting people to support their lives and focus on healing. Overcoming Myths About Addiction Treatment
There are lots of mistaken beliefs bordering addiction therapy, specifically when it concerns medication-assisted strategies. Some believe that utilizing methadone or various other medications just changes one dependency with another. This is far from the reality.
Methadone and comparable medications are very carefully managed and prescribed under medical supervision. They work by stabilizing mind chemistry and reducing the overwhelming desire to make use of opioids. Unlike unattended addiction, MAT permits people to function usually, hold tasks, and rebuild their lives. Education is type in taking apart misconceptions and motivating individuals to seek ideal treatment.
